.splitscreen .splitscreen-panel{padding:30px}@media (min-width:690px){.splitscreen .splitscreen-panel{padding:60px}}@media (min-width:920px){.splitscreen{display:flex;flex-direction:row;align-items:stretch;min-height:100vh}.splitscreen .splitscreen-panel{width:50%}}.demo-customer-strip img{display:block;margin:2rem auto}@media (min-width:920px){.demo-customer-strip{display:block}.demo-customer-strip img{display:inline-block;max-width:15%}.demo-customer-strip img+img{margin-left:5%}}.quote-text{font-size:1.65rem;color:#000}.lights-out .quote-text{color:#fff}